Problem
Existing image pickup apparatuses record moving image data regardless of changes in shooting direction, resulting in unwanted vibrating picture screens during reproduction.
Innovation Solution
An image pickup apparatus that detects the shooting direction and attitude using a three-axis geomagnetic sensor, temporarily stores moving image data, and deletes portions based on detected changes to record only desired data, preventing unintended image recording.

An image pickup apparatus includes an image pickup unit that picks up an object to generate moving image data. A detection unit detects one of a shooting direction of the image pickup unit and an attitude of the image pickup apparatus. A storage unit temporarily stores moving image data generated by the image pickup unit. An instruction unit instructs operation to photograph a still image. A recording unit reads out the moving image data traced back by a predetermined time period from a time point when still image photographing is instructed by the instruction unit, from the storage unit, and records the read-out moving image data in a recording medium. The recording unit records, relatedly with the moving image data, information concerning the detected one of the shooting direction and the attitude of the image pickup apparatus.
